Surah Al-Anfal — The Spoils of War

Surah 8 · 75 ayahs · Medinan

Ayah 1

يَسْـَٔلُوْنَكَ عَنِ الْاَنْفَالِۗ قُلِ الْاَنْفَالُ لِلّٰهِ وَالرَّسُوْلِۚ فَاتَّقُوا اللّٰهَ وَاَصْلِحُوْا ذَاتَ بَيْنِكُمْ ۖوَاَطِيْعُوا اللّٰهَ وَرَسُوْلَهٗٓ اِنْ كُنْتُمْ مُّؤْمِنِيْنَ

Yas'alūnaka ‘anil-anfāl(i), qulil-anfālu lillāhi war-rasūl(i), fattaqullāha wa aṣliḥū żāta bainikum, wa aṭī‘ullāha wa rasūlahū in kuntum mu'minīn(a).

They ask you, [O Muḥammad], about the bounties [of war]. Say, "The [decision concerning] bounties is for Allāh and the Messenger." So fear Allāh and amend that which is between you and obey Allāh and His Messenger, if you should be believers.

Ayah 2

اِنَّمَا الْمُؤْمِنُوْنَ الَّذِيْنَ اِذَا ذُكِرَ اللّٰهُ وَجِلَتْ قُلُوْبُهُمْ وَاِذَا تُلِيَتْ عَلَيْهِمْ اٰيٰتُهٗ زَادَتْهُمْ اِيْمَانًا وَّعَلٰى رَبِّهِمْ يَتَوَكَّلُوْنَۙ

Innamal-mu'minūnal-lażīna iżā żukirallāhu wajilat qulūbuhum wa iżā tuliyat ‘alaihim āyātuhū zādathum īmānaw wa ‘alā rabbihim yatawakkalūn(a).

The believers are only those who, when Allāh is mentioned, their hearts become fearful, and when His verses are recited to them, it increases them in faith; and upon their Lord they rely -

Ayah 3

الَّذِيْنَ يُقِيْمُوْنَ الصَّلٰوةَ وَمِمَّا رَزَقْنٰهُمْ يُنْفِقُوْنَۗ

Al-lażīna yuqīmūnaṣ-ṣalāta wa mimmā razaqnāhum yunfiqūn(a).

The ones who establish prayer, and from what We have provided them, they spend.

Ayah 4

اُولٰۤىِٕكَ هُمُ الْمُؤْمِنُوْنَ حَقًّاۗ لَهُمْ دَرَجٰتٌ عِنْدَ رَبِّهِمْ وَمَغْفِرَةٌ وَّرِزْقٌ كَرِيْمٌۚ

Ulā'ika humul-mu'minūna ḥaqqā(n), lahum darajātun ‘inda rabbihim wa magfiratuw wa rizqun karīm(un).

Those are the believers, truly. For them are degrees [of high position] with their Lord and forgiveness and noble provision.

Ayah 5

كَمَآ اَخْرَجَكَ رَبُّكَ مِنْۢ بَيْتِكَ بِالْحَقِّۖ وَاِنَّ فَرِيْقًا مِّنَ الْمُؤْمِنِيْنَ لَكٰرِهُوْنَ

Kamā akhrajaka rabbuka mim baitika bil-ḥaqq(i), wa inna farīqam minal-mu'minīna lakārihūn(a).

[It is] just as when your Lord brought you out of your home [for the battle of Badr] in truth, while indeed, a party among the believers were unwilling,

Ayah 6

يُجَادِلُوْنَكَ فِى الْحَقِّ بَعْدَمَا تَبَيَّنَ كَاَنَّمَا يُسَاقُوْنَ اِلَى الْمَوْتِ وَهُمْ يَنْظُرُوْنَ ۗ

Yujādilūnaka fil-ḥaqqi ba‘da mā tabayyana ka'annamā yusāqūna ilal-mauti wa hum yanẓurūn(a).

Arguing with you concerning the truth after it had become clear, as if they were being driven toward death while they were looking on.

Ayah 7

وَاِذْ يَعِدُكُمُ اللّٰهُ اِحْدَى الطَّاۤىِٕفَتَيْنِ اَنَّهَا لَكُمْ وَتَوَدُّوْنَ اَنَّ غَيْرَ ذَاتِ الشَّوْكَةِ تَكُوْنُ لَكُمْ وَيُرِيْدُ اللّٰهُ اَنْ يُّحِقَّ الْحَقَّ بِكَلِمٰتِهٖ وَيَقْطَعَ دَابِرَ الْكٰفِرِيْنَۙ

Wa iż ya‘idukumullāhu iḥdaṭ-ṭā'ifataini annahā lakum wa tawaddūna anna gaira żātisy-syaukati takūnu lakum wa yurīdullāhu ay yuḥiqqal-ḥaqqa bikalimātihī wa yaqṭa‘a dābiral-kāfirīn(a).

[Remember, O believers], when Allāh promised you one of the two groups - that it would be yours - and you wished that the unarmed one would be yours. But Allāh intended to establish the truth by His words and to eliminate the disbelievers

Ayah 8

لِيُحِقَّ الْحَقَّ وَيُبْطِلَ الْبَاطِلَ وَلَوْ كَرِهَ الْمُجْرِمُوْنَۚ

Liyuḥiqqal-ḥaqqa wa yubṭilal-bāṭila wa lau karihal-mujrimūn(a).

That He should establish the truth and abolish falsehood, even if the criminals disliked it.

Ayah 9

اِذْ تَسْتَغِيْثُوْنَ رَبَّكُمْ فَاسْتَجَابَ لَكُمْ اَنِّيْ مُمِدُّكُمْ بِاَلْفٍ مِّنَ الْمَلٰۤىِٕكَةِ مُرْدِفِيْنَ

Iż tastagīṡūna rabbakum fastajāba lakum annī mumiddukum bi'alfim minal-malā'ikati murdifīn(a).

[Remember] when you were asking help of your Lord, and He answered you, "Indeed, I will reinforce you with a thousand from the angels, following one another."

Ayah 10

وَمَا جَعَلَهُ اللّٰهُ اِلَّا بُشْرٰى وَلِتَطْمَىِٕنَّ بِهٖ قُلُوْبُكُمْۗ وَمَا النَّصْرُ اِلَّا مِنْ عِنْدِ اللّٰهِ ۗاِنَّ اللّٰهَ عَزِيْزٌ حَكِيْمٌ ࣖ

Wa mā ja‘alahullāhu illā busyrā wa litaṭma'inna bihī qulūbukum, wa man-naṡru illā min ‘indillāh(i), innallāha ‘azīzun ḥakīm(un).

And Allāh made it not but good tidings and so that your hearts would be assured thereby. And victory is not but from Allāh. Indeed, Allāh is Exalted in Might and Wise.

Ayah 11

اِذْ يُغَشِّيْكُمُ النُّعَاسَ اَمَنَةً مِّنْهُ وَيُنَزِّلُ عَلَيْكُمْ مِّنَ السَّمَاۤءِ مَاۤءً لِّيُطَهِّرَكُمْ بِهٖ وَيُذْهِبَ عَنْكُمْ رِجْزَ الشَّيْطٰنِ وَلِيَرْبِطَ عَلٰى قُلُوْبِكُمْ وَيُثَبِّتَ بِهِ الْاَقْدَامَۗ

Iż yugasysyīkumun-nu‘āsa amanatam minhu wa yunazzilu ‘alaikum minas-samā'i mā'al liyuṭahhirakum bihī wa yużhiba ‘ankum rijzasy-syaiṭāni wa liyarbiṭa ‘alā qulūbikum wa yuṡabbita bihil-aqdām(a).

[Remember] when He overwhelmed you with drowsiness [giving] security from Him and sent down upon you from the sky, rain by which to purify you and remove from you the evil [suggestions] of Satan and to make steadfast your hearts and plant firmly thereby your feet.

Ayah 12

اِذْ يُوْحِيْ رَبُّكَ اِلَى الْمَلٰۤىِٕكَةِ اَنِّيْ مَعَكُمْ فَثَبِّتُوا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ْاۗ سَاُلْقِيْ فِيْ قُلُوْبِ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وا الرُّعْبَ فَاضْرِبُوْا فَوْقَ الْاَعْنَاقِ وَاضْرِبُوْا مِنْهُمْ كُلَّ بَنَانٍۗ

Iż yūḥī rabbuka ilal-malā'ikati annī ma‘akum fa ṡabbitul-lażīna āmanū, sa'ulqī fī qulūbil-lażīna kafarur-ru‘ba faḍribū fauqal-a‘nāqi waḍribū minhum kulla banān(in).

[Remember] when your Lord inspired to the angels, "I am with you, so strengthen those who have believed. I will cast terror into the hearts of those who disbelieved, so strike [them] upon the necks and strike from them every fingertip."

Ayah 13

ذٰلِكَ بِاَنَّهُمْ شَاۤقُّوا اللّٰهَ وَرَسُوْلَهٗۚ وَمَنْ يُّشَاقِقِ اللّٰهَ وَرَسُوْلَهٗ فَاِنَّ اللّٰهَ شَدِيْدُ الْعِقَابِ

Żālika bi'annahum syāqqullāha wa rasūlah(ū), wa may yusyāqiqillāha wa rasūlahū fa innallāha syadīdul-‘iqāb(i).

That is because they opposed Allāh and His Messenger. And whoever opposes Allāh and His Messenger - indeed, Allāh is severe in penalty.

Ayah 14

ذٰلِكُمْ فَذُوْقُوْهُ وَاَنَّ لِلْكٰفِرِيْنَ عَذَابَ النَّارِ

Żālikum fa żūqūhu wa anna lil-kāfirīna ‘ażāban-nār(i).

"That [is yours], so taste it." And indeed for the disbelievers is the punishment of the Fire.

Ayah 15

يٰٓاَيُّهَا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ْٓا اِذَا لَقِيْتُمُ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ا زَحْفًا فَلَا تُوَلُّوْهُمُ الْاَدْبَارَۚ

Yā ayyuhal-lażīna āmanū iżā laqītumul-lażīna kafarū zaḥfan falā tuwallūhumul-adbār(a).

O you who have believed, when you meet those who disbelieve advancing [in battle], do not turn to them your backs [in flight].

Ayah 16

وَمَنْ يُّوَلِّهِمْ يَوْمَىِٕذٍ دُبُرَهٗٓ اِلَّا مُتَحَرِّفًا لِّقِتَالٍ اَوْ مُتَحَيِّزًا اِلٰى فِئَةٍ فَقَدْ بَاۤءَ بِغَضَبٍ مِّنَ اللّٰهِ وَمَأْوٰىهُ جَهَنَّمُ ۗ وَبِئْسَ الْمَصِيْرُ

Wa may yuwallihim yauma'iżin duburahū illā mutaḥarrifal liqitālin au mutaḥayyizan ilā fi'atin faqad bā'a bigaḍabim minallāhi wa ma'wāhu jahannam(u), wa bi'sal-maṣīr(u).

And whoever turns his back to them on such a day, unless swerving [as a strategy] for war or joining [another] company, has certainly returned with anger [upon him] from Allāh, and his refuge is Hell - and wretched is the destination.

Ayah 17

فَلَمْ تَقْتُلُوْهُمْ وَلٰكِنَّ اللّٰهَ قَتَلَهُمْۖ وَمَا رَمَيْتَ اِذْ رَمَيْتَ وَلٰكِنَّ اللّٰهَ رَمٰىۚ وَلِيُبْلِيَ الْمُؤْمِنِيْنَ مِنْهُ بَلَاۤءً حَسَنًاۗ اِنَّ اللّٰهَ سَمِيْعٌ عَلِيْمٌ

Falam taqtulūhum wa lākinnallāha qatalahum, wa mā ramaita iż ramaita wa lākinallāha ramā, wa liyubliyal-mu'minīna minhu balā'an ḥasanā(n), innallāha samī‘un ‘alīm(un).

And you did not kill them, but it was Allāh who killed them. And you threw not, [O Muḥammad], when you threw, but it was Allāh who threw that He might test the believers with a good test. Indeed, Allāh is Hearing and Knowing.

Ayah 18

ذٰلِكُمْ وَاَنَّ اللّٰهَ مُوْهِنُ كَيْدِ الْكٰفِرِيْنَ

Żālikum wa annallāha mūhinu kaidil-kāfirīn(a).

That [is so], and [also] that Allāh will weaken the plot of the disbelievers.

Ayah 19

اِنْ تَسْتَفْتِحُوْا فَقَدْ جَاۤءَكُمُ الْفَتْحُۚ وَاِنْ تَنْتَهُوْا فَهُوَ خَيْرٌ لَّكُمْۚ وَاِنْ تَعُوْدُوْا نَعُدْۚ وَلَنْ تُغْنِيَ عَنْكُمْ فِئَتُكُمْ شَيْـًٔا وَّلَوْ كَثُرَتْۙ وَاَنَّ اللّٰهَ مَعَ الْمُؤْمِنِيْنَ ࣖ

In tastaftiḥū faqad jā'akumul-fatḥ(u), wa in tantahū fa huwa khairul lakum, wa in ta‘ūdū na‘ud, wa lan tugniya ‘ankum fi'atukum syai'aw wa lau kaṡurat, wa anallāha ma‘al-mu'minīn(a).

If you [disbelievers] seek the decision [i.e., victory] - the decision [i.e., defeat] has come to you. And if you desist [from hostilities], it is best for you; but if you return [to war], We will return, and never will you be availed by your [large] company at all, even if it should increase; and [that is] because Allāh is with the believers.

Ayah 20

يٰٓاَيُّهَا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ْٓا اَطِيْعُوا اللّٰهَ وَرَسُوْلَهٗ وَلَا تَوَلَّوْا عَنْهُ وَاَنْتُمْ تَسْمَعُوْنَ

Yā ayyuhal-lażīna āmanū aṭī‘ullāha wa rasūlahū wa lā tawallau ‘anhu wa antum tasma‘ūn(a).

O you who have believed, obey Allāh and His Messenger and do not turn from him while you hear [his order].

Ayah 21

وَلَا تَكُوْنُوْا كَالَّذِيْنَ قَالُوْا سَمِعْنَا وَهُمْ لَا يَسْمَعُوْنَۚ

Wa lā takūnū kal-lażīna qālū sami‘nā wa hum lā yasma‘ūn(a).

And do not be like those who say, "We have heard," while they do not hear.

Ayah 22

۞ اِنَّ شَرَّ الدَّوَاۤبِّ عِنْدَ اللّٰهِ الصُّمُّ الْبُكْمُ الَّذِيْنَ لَا يَعْقِلُوْنَ

Inna syarrad-dawābbi ‘indallāhiṣ-ṣummul-bukmul-lażīna lā ya‘qilūn(a).

Indeed, the worst of living creatures in the sight of Allāh are the deaf and dumb who do not use reason [i.e., the disbelievers].

Ayah 23

وَلَوْ عَلِمَ اللّٰهُ فِيْهِمْ خَيْرًا لَّاَسْمَعَهُمْۗ وَلَوْ اَسْمَعَهُمْ لَتَوَلَّوْا وَّهُمْ مُّعْرِضُوْنَ

Wa lau ‘alimallāhu fīhim khairal la'asma‘ahum, wa lau asma‘ahum latawallau wa hum mu‘riḍūn(a).

Had Allāh known any good in them, He would have made them hear. And if He had made them hear, they would [still] have turned away, while they were refusing.

Ayah 24

يٰٓاَيُّهَا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وا اسْتَجِيْبُوْا لِلّٰهِ وَلِلرَّسُوْلِ اِذَا دَعَاكُمْ لِمَا يُحْيِيْكُمْۚ وَاعْلَمُوْٓا اَنَّ اللّٰهَ يَحُوْلُ بَيْنَ الْمَرْءِ وَقَلْبِهٖ وَاَنَّهٗٓ اِلَيْهِ تُحْشَرُوْنَ

Yā ayyuhal-lażīna āmanustajībū lillāhi wa lir-rasūli iżā da‘ākum limā yuḥyīkum, wa‘lamū annallāha yaḥūlu bainal-mar'i wa qalbihī wa annahū ilaihi tuḥsyarūn(a).

O you who have believed, respond to Allāh and to the Messenger when he calls you to that which gives you life. And know that Allāh intervenes between a man and his heart and that to Him you will be gathered.

Ayah 25

وَاتَّقُوْا فِتْنَةً لَّا تُصِيْبَنَّ الَّذِيْنَ ظَلَمُوْا مِنْكُمْ خَاۤصَّةً ۚوَاعْلَمُوْٓا اَنَّ اللّٰهَ شَدِيْدُ الْعِقَابِ

Wattaqū fitnatal lā tuṣībannal-lażīna ẓalamū minkum khāṣṣah(tan), wa‘lamū annallāha syadīdul-‘iqāb(i).

And fear a trial which will not strike those who have wronged among you exclusively, and know that Allāh is severe in penalty.

Ayah 26

وَاذْكُرُوْٓا اِذْ اَنْتُمْ قَلِيْلٌ مُّسْتَضْعَفُوْنَ فِى الْاَرْضِ تَخَافُوْنَ اَنْ يَّتَخَطَّفَكُمُ النَّاسُ فَاٰوٰىكُمْ وَاَيَّدَكُمْ بِنَصْرِهٖ وَرَزَقَكُمْ مِّنَ الطَّيِّبٰتِ لَعَلَّكُمْ تَشْكُرُوْنَ

Ważkurū iż antum qalīlum mustaḍ‘afūna fil-arḍi takhāfūna ay yatakhaṭṭafakumun-nāsu fa āwākum wa ayyadakum binaṣrihī wa razaqakum minaṭ-ṭayyibāti la‘allakum tasykurūn(a).

And remember when you were few and oppressed in the land, fearing that people might abduct you, but He sheltered you, supported you with His victory, and provided you with good things - that you might be grateful.

Ayah 27

يٰٓاَيُّهَا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ْا لَا تَخُوْنُوا اللّٰهَ وَالرَّسُوْلَ وَتَخُوْنُوْٓا اَمٰنٰتِكُمْ وَاَنْتُمْ تَعْلَمُوْنَ

Yā ayyuhal-lażīna āmanū lā takhūnullāha war-rasūla wa takhūnū amānātikum wa antum ta‘lamūn(a).

O you who have believed, do not betray Allāh and the Messenger or betray your trusts while you know [the consequence].

Ayah 28

وَاعْلَمُوْٓا اَنَّمَآ اَمْوَالُكُمْ وَاَوْلَادُكُمْ فِتْنَةٌ ۙوَّاَنَّ اللّٰهَ عِنْدَهٗٓ اَجْرٌ عَظِيْمٌ ࣖ

Wa‘lamū annamā amwālukum wa aulādukum fitnah(tun), wa annallāha ‘indahū ajrun ‘aẓīm(un).

And know that your properties and your children are but a trial and that Allāh has with Him a great reward.

Ayah 29

يٰٓاَيُّهَا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ْٓا اِنْ تَتَّقُوا اللّٰهَ يَجْعَلْ لَّكُمْ فُرْقَانًا وَّيُكَفِّرْ عَنْكُمْ سَيِّاٰتِكُمْ وَيَغْفِرْ لَكُمْۗ وَاللّٰهُ ذُو الْفَضْلِ الْعَظِيْمِ

Yā ayyuhal-lażīna āmanū in tattaqullāha yaj‘al lakum furqānaw wa yukaffir ‘ankum sayyi'ātikum wa yagfir lakum, wallāhu żul-faḍlil-‘aẓīm(i).

O you who have believed, if you fear Allāh, He will grant you a criterion and will remove from you your misdeeds and forgive you. And Allāh is the possessor of great bounty.

Ayah 30

وَاِذْ يَمْكُرُ بِكَ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ا لِيُثْبِتُوْكَ اَوْ يَقْتُلُوْكَ اَوْ يُخْرِجُوْكَۗ وَيَمْكُرُوْنَ وَيَمْكُرُ اللّٰهُ ۗوَاللّٰهُ خَيْرُ الْمٰكِرِيْنَ

Wa iż yamkuru bikal-lażīna kafarū liyuṡbitūka au yaqtulūka au yukhrijūk(a), wa yamkurūna wa yamkurullāh(u), wallāhu khairul-mākirīn(a).

And [remember, O Muḥammad], when those who disbelieved plotted against you to restrain you or kill you or evict you [from Makkah]. But they plan, and Allāh plans. And Allāh is the best of planners.

Ayah 31

وَاِذَا تُتْلٰى عَلَيْهِمْ اٰيٰتُنَا قَالُوْا قَدْ سَمِعْنَا لَوْ نَشَاۤءُ لَقُلْنَا مِثْلَ هٰذَآ ۙاِنْ هٰذَآ اِلَّآ اَسَاطِيْرُ الْاَوَّلِيْنَ

Wa iżā tutlā ‘alaihim āyātunā qālū qad sami‘nā lau nasyā'u laqulnā miṡla hāżā, in hāżā illā asāṭīrul-awwalīn(a).

And when Our verses are recited to them, they say, "We have heard. If we willed, we could say [something] like this. This is not but legends of the former peoples."

Ayah 32

وَاِذْ قَالُوا اللّٰهُمَّ اِنْ كَانَ هٰذَا هُوَ الْحَقَّ مِنْ عِنْدِكَ فَاَمْطِرْ عَلَيْنَا حِجَارَةً مِّنَ السَّمَاۤءِ اَوِ ائْتِنَا بِعَذَابٍ اَلِيْمٍ

Wa iż qālullāhumma in kāna hāżā huwal-ḥaqqa min ‘indika fa amṭir ‘alainā ḥijāratam minas-samā'i awi'tinā bi‘ażābin alīm(in).

And [remember] when they said, "O Allāh, if this should be the truth from You, then rain down upon us stones from the sky or bring us a painful punishment."

Ayah 33

وَمَا كَانَ اللّٰهُ لِيُعَذِّبَهُمْ وَاَنْتَ فِيْهِمْۚ وَمَا كَانَ اللّٰهُ مُعَذِّبَهُمْ وَهُمْ يَسْتَغْفِرُوْنَ

Wa mā kānallāhu liyu‘ażżibahum wa anta fīhim, wa mā kānallāhu mu‘ażżibahum wa hum yastagfirūn(a).

But Allāh would not punish them while you, [O Muḥammad], are among them, and Allāh would not punish them while they seek forgiveness.

Ayah 34

وَمَا لَهُمْ اَلَّا يُعَذِّبَهُمُ اللّٰهُ وَهُمْ يَصُدُّوْنَ عَنِ الْمَسْجِدِ الْحَرَامِ وَمَا كَانُوْٓا اَوْلِيَاۤءَهٗۗ اِنْ اَوْلِيَاۤؤُهٗٓ اِلَّا الْمُتَّقُوْنَ وَلٰكِنَّ اَكْثَرَهُمْ لَا يَعْلَمُوْنَ

Wa mā lahum allā yu‘ażżibahumullāhu wa hum yaṣuddūna ‘anil-masjidil-ḥarāmi wa mā kānū auliyā'ah(ū), in auliyā'uhū illal-muttaqūna wa lākinna akṡarahum lā ya‘lamūn(a).

But why should Allāh not punish them while they obstruct [people] from al-Masjid al-Ḥarām and they were not [fit to be] its guardians? Its [true] guardians are not but the righteous, but most of them do not know.

Ayah 35

وَمَا كَانَ صَلَاتُهُمْ عِنْدَ الْبَيْتِ اِلَّا مُكَاۤءً وَّتَصْدِيَةًۗ فَذُوْقُوا الْعَذَابَ بِمَا كُنْتُمْ تَكْفُرُوْنَ

Wa mā kāna ṣalātuhum ‘indal-baiti illā mukā'aw wa taṣdiyah(tan), fa żūqul-‘ażāba bimā kuntum takfurūn(a).

And their prayer at the House [i.e., the Kaʿbah] was not except whistling and handclapping. So taste the punishment for what you disbelieved [i.e., practiced of deviations].

Ayah 36

اِنَّ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ا يُنْفِقُوْنَ اَمْوَالَهُمْ لِيَصُدُّوْا عَنْ سَبِيْلِ اللّٰهِ ۗفَسَيُنْفِقُوْنَهَا ثُمَّ تَكُوْنُ عَلَيْهِمْ حَسْرَةً ثُمَّ يُغْلَبُوْنَ ەۗ وَالَ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ْٓا اِلٰى جَهَنَّمَ يُحْشَرُوْنَۙ

Innal-lażīna kafarū yunfiqūna amwālahum liyaṣuddū ‘an sabīlillāh(i), fa sayunfiqūnahā ṡumma takūnu ‘alaihim ḥasratan ṡumma yuglabūn(a), wal-lażīna kafarū ilā jahannama yuḥsyarūn(a).

Indeed, those who disbelieve spend their wealth to avert [people] from the way of Allāh. So they will spend it; then it will be for them a [source of] regret; then they will be overcome. And those who have disbelieved - unto Hell they will be gathered.

Ayah 37

لِيَمِيْزَ اللّٰهُ الْخَبِيْثَ مِنَ الطَّيِّبِ وَيَجْعَلَ الْخَبِيْثَ بَعْضَهٗ عَلٰى بَعْضٍ فَيَرْكُمَهٗ جَمِيْعًا فَيَجْعَلَهٗ فِيْ جَهَنَّمَۗ اُولٰۤىِٕكَ هُمُ الْخٰسِرُوْنَ ࣖ

Liyamīzallāhul-khabīṡa minaṭ-ṭayyibi wa yaj‘alal-khabīṡa ba‘ḍahū ‘alā ba‘ḍin fa yarkumahū jamī‘an fa yaj‘alahū fī jahannam(a), ulā'ika humul-khāsirūn(a).

[It is] so that Allāh may distinguish the wicked from the good and place the wicked some of them upon others and heap them all together and put them into Hell. It is those who are the losers.

Ayah 38

قُلْ لِّلَ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ْٓا اِنْ يَّنْتَهُوْا يُغْفَرْ لَهُمْ مَّا قَدْ سَلَفَۚ وَاِنْ يَّعُوْدُوْا فَقَدْ مَضَتْ سُنَّتُ الْاَوَّلِيْنَ

Qul lil-lażīna kafarū in yantahū yugfar lahum mā qad salaf(a), wa iy ya‘ūdū faqad maḍat sunnatul-awwalīn(a).

Say to those who have disbelieved [that] if they cease, what has previously occurred will be forgiven for them. But if they return [to hostility] - then the precedent of the former [rebellious] peoples has already taken place.

Ayah 39

وَقَاتِلُوْهُمْ حَتّٰى لَا تَكُوْنَ فِتْنَةٌ وَّيَكُوْنَ الدِّيْنُ كُلُّهٗ لِلّٰهِۚ فَاِنِ انْتَهَوْا فَاِنَّ اللّٰهَ بِمَا يَعْمَلُوْنَ بَصِيْرٌ

Wa qātilūhum ḥattā lā takūna fitnatuw wa yakunad-dīnu kulluhū lillāh(i),fa inintahau fa innallāha bimā ya‘malūna baṣīr(un).

And fight against them until there is no fitnah and [until] the religion [i.e., worship], all of it, is for Allāh. And if they cease - then indeed, Allāh is Seeing of what they do.

Ayah 40

وَاِنْ تَوَلَّوْا فَاعْلَمُوْٓا اَنَّ اللّٰهَ مَوْلٰىكُمْ ۗنِعْمَ الْمَوْلٰى وَنِعْمَ النَّصِيْرُ ۔

Wa in tawallau fa‘lamū annallāha maulākum, ni‘mal-maulā wa ni‘man-naṣīr(u).

But if they turn away - then know that Allāh is your protector. Excellent is the protector, and excellent is the helper.

Ayah 41

۞ وَاعْلَمُوْٓا اَنَّمَا غَنِمْتُمْ مِّنْ شَيْءٍ فَاَنَّ لِلّٰهِ خُمُسَهٗ وَلِلرَّسُوْلِ وَلِذِى الْقُرْبٰى وَالْيَتٰمٰى وَالْمَسٰكِيْنِ وَابْنِ السَّبِيْلِ اِنْ كُنْتُمْ اٰمَنْتُمْ بِاللّٰهِ وَمَآ اَنْزَلْنَا عَلٰى عَبْدِنَا يَوْمَ الْفُرْقَانِ يَوْمَ الْتَقَى الْجَمْعٰنِۗ وَاللّٰهُ عَلٰى كُلِّ شَيْءٍ قَدِيْرٌ

Wa‘lamū annamā ganimtum min syai'in fa anna lillāhi khumusahū wa lir-rasūli wa liżil-qurbā wal-yatāmā wal-masākīni wabnis-sabīli in kuntum āmantum billāhi wa mā anzalnā ‘alā ‘abdinā yaumal-furqāni yaumal-taqal-jam‘ān(i), wallāhu ‘alā kulli syai'in qadīr(un).

And know that anything you obtain of war booty - then indeed, for Allāh is one fifth of it and for the Messenger and for [his] near relatives and the orphans, the needy, and the [stranded] traveler, if you have believed in Allāh and in that which We sent down to Our Servant on the day of criterion [i.e., decisive encounter] - the day when the two armies met [at Badr]. And Allāh, over all things, is competent.

Ayah 42

اِذْ اَنْتُمْ بِالْعُدْوَةِ الدُّنْيَا وَهُمْ بِالْعُدْوَةِ الْقُصْوٰى وَالرَّكْبُ اَسْفَلَ مِنْكُمْۗ وَلَوْ تَوَاعَدْتُّمْ لَاخْتَلَفْتُمْ فِى الْمِيْعٰدِۙ وَلٰكِنْ لِّيَقْضِيَ اللّٰهُ اَمْرًا كَانَ مَفْعُوْلًا ەۙ لِّيَهْلِكَ مَنْ هَلَكَ عَنْۢ بَيِّنَةٍ وَّيَحْيٰى مَنْ حَيَّ عَنْۢ بَيِّنَةٍۗ وَاِنَّ اللّٰهَ لَسَمِيْعٌ عَلِيْمٌۙ

Iż antum bil-‘udwatid-dun-yā wa hum bil-‘udwatil-quṣwā war-rakbu asfala minkum, wa lau tawā‘attum lakhtalaftum fil-mī‘ād(i), wa lākil liyaqḍiyallāhu amran kāna maf‘ūlā(n), liyahlika man halaka ‘am bayyinatiw wa yaḥyā may ḥayya ‘am bayyinah(tin), wa innallāha lasamī‘un ‘alīm(un).

[Remember] when you were on the near side of the valley, and they were on the farther side, and the caravan was lower [in position] than you. If you had made an appointment [to meet], you would have missed the appointment. But [it was] so that Allāh might accomplish a matter already destined - that those who perished [through disbelief] would perish upon evidence and those who lived [in faith] would live upon evidence; and indeed, Allāh is Hearing and Knowing.

Ayah 43

اِذْ يُرِيْكَهُمُ اللّٰهُ فِيْ مَنَامِكَ قَلِيْلًاۗ وَلَوْ اَرٰىكَهُمْ كَثِيْرًا لَّفَشِلْتُمْ وَلَتَنَازَعْتُمْ فِى الْاَمْرِ وَلٰكِنَّ اللّٰهَ سَلَّمَۗ اِنَّهٗ عَلِيْمٌۢ بِذَاتِ الصُّدُوْرِ

Iż yurīkahumullāhu fī manāmika qalīlā(n), wa lau arākahum kaṡīral lafasyiltum wa latanāza‘tum fil-amri wa lākinnallāha sallam(a), innahū ‘alīmum biżātiṣ-ṣudūr(i).

[Remember, O Muḥammad], when Allāh showed them to you in your dream as few; and if He had shown them to you as many, you [believers] would have lost courage and would have disputed in the matter [of whether to fight], but Allāh saved [you from that]. Indeed, He is Knowing of that within the breasts.

Ayah 44

وَاِذْ يُرِيْكُمُوْهُمْ اِذِ الْتَقَيْتُمْ فِيْٓ اَعْيُنِكُمْ قَلِيْلًا وَّيُقَلِّلُكُمْ فِيْٓ اَعْيُنِهِمْ لِيَقْضِيَ اللّٰهُ اَمْرًا كَانَ مَفْعُوْلًا ۗوَاِلَى اللّٰهِ تُرْجَعُ الْاُمُوْرُ ࣖ

Wa iż yurīkumūhum iżil-taqaitum fī a‘yunikum qalīlaw wa yuqallilukum fī a‘yunihim liyaqḍiyallāhu amran kāna maf‘ūlā(n), wa ilallāhi turja‘ul-umūr(u).

And [remember] when He showed them to you, when you met, as few in your eyes, and He made you [appear] as few in their eyes so that Allāh might accomplish a matter already destined. And to Allāh are [all] matters returned.

Ayah 45

يٰٓاَيُّهَا ال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ْٓا اِذَا لَقِيْتُمْ فِئَةً فَاثْبُتُوْا وَاذْكُرُوا اللّٰهَ كَثِيْرًا لَّعَلَّكُمْ تُفْلِحُوْنَۚ

Yā ayyuhal-lażīna āmanū iżā laqītum fi'atan faṡbutū ważkurullāha kaṡīral la‘allakum tufliḥūn(a).

O you who have believed, when you encounter a company [from the enemy forces], stand firm and remember Allāh much that you may be successful.

Ayah 46

وَاَطِيْعُوا اللّٰهَ وَرَسُوْلَهٗ وَلَا تَنَازَعُوْا فَتَفْشَلُوْا وَتَذْهَبَ رِيْحُكُمْ وَاصْبِرُوْاۗ اِنَّ اللّٰهَ مَعَ الصّٰبِرِيْنَۚ

Wa aṭī‘ullāha wa rasūlahū wa lā tanāza‘ū fa tafsyalū wa tażhaba rīḥukum waṣbirū, innallāha ma‘aṣ-ṣābirīn(a).

And obey Allāh and His Messenger, and do not dispute and [thus] lose courage and [then] your strength would depart; and be patient. Indeed, Allāh is with the patient.

Ayah 47

وَلَا تَكُوْنُوْا كَالَّذِيْنَ خَرَجُوْا مِنْ دِيَارِهِمْ بَطَرًا وَّرِئَاۤءَ النَّاسِ وَيَصُدُّوْنَ عَنْ سَبِيْلِ اللّٰهِ ۗوَاللّٰهُ بِمَايَعْمَلُوْنَ مُحِيْطٌ

Wa lā takūnū kal-lażīna kharajū min diyārihim baṭaraw wa ri'ā'an-nāsi wa yaṣuddūna ‘an sabīlillāh(i), wallāhu bimā ya‘malūna muḥīṭ(un).

And do not be like those who came forth from their homes insolently and to be seen by people and avert [them] from the way of Allāh. And Allāh is encompassing of what they do.

Ayah 48

وَاِذْ زَيَّنَ لَهُمُ الشَّيْطٰنُ اَعْمَالَهُمْ وَقَالَ لَا غَالِبَ لَكُمُ الْيَوْمَ مِنَ النَّاسِ وَاِنِّيْ جَارٌ لَّكُمْۚ فَلَمَّا تَرَاۤءَتِ الْفِئَتٰنِ نَكَصَ عَلٰى عَقِبَيْهِ وَقَالَ اِنِّيْ بَرِيْۤءٌ مِّنْكُمْ اِنِّيْٓ اَرٰى مَا لَا تَرَوْنَ اِنِّيْٓ اَخَافُ اللّٰهَ ۗوَاللّٰهُ شَدِيْدُ الْعِقَابِ ࣖ

Wa iż zayyana lahumusy-syaiṭānu a‘mālahum wa qāla lā gāliba lakumul-yauma minan-nāsi wa innī jārul lakum, falammā tarā'atil-fi'atāni nakaṣa ‘alā ‘aqibaihi wa qāla innī barī'um minkum innī arā mā lā tarauna innī akhāfullāh(a), wallāhu syadīdul-‘iqāb(i).

And [remember] when Satan made their deeds pleasing to them and said, "No one can overcome you today from among the people, and indeed, I am your protector." But when the two armies sighted each other, he turned on his heels and said, "Indeed, I am disassociated from you. Indeed, I see what you do not see; indeed, I fear Allāh. And Allāh is severe in penalty."

Ayah 49

اِذْ يَقُوْلُ الْمُنٰفِقُوْنَ وَالَّذِيْنَ فِيْ قُلُوْبِهِمْ مَّرَضٌ غَرَّ هٰٓؤُلَاۤءِ دِيْنُهُمْۗ وَمَنْ يَّتَوَكَّلْ عَلَى اللّٰهِ فَاِنَّ اللّٰهَ عَزِيْزٌ حَكِيْمٌ

Iż yaqūlul-munāfiqūna wal-lażīna fī qulūbihim maraḍun garra hā'ulā'i dīnuhum, wa may yatawakkal ‘alallāhi fa innallāha ‘azīzun ḥakīm(un).

[Remember] when the hypocrites and those in whose hearts was disease [i.e., arrogance and disbelief] said, "Their religion has deluded those [Muslims]." But whoever relies upon Allāh - then indeed, Allāh is Exalted in Might and Wise.

Ayah 50

وَلَوْ تَرٰٓى اِذْ يَتَوَفَّى ال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وا الْمَلٰۤىِٕكَةُ يَضْرِبُوْنَ وُجُوْهَهُمْ وَاَدْبَارَهُمْۚ وَذُوْقُوْا عَذَابَ الْحَرِيْقِ

Wa lau tarā iż yatawaffal-lażīna kafarul-malā'ikatu yaḍribūna wujūhahum wa adbārahum, wa żūqū ‘ażābal-ḥarīq(i).

And if you could but see when the angels take the souls of those who disbelieved... They are striking their faces and their backs and [saying], "Taste the punishment of the Burning Fire.

Ayah 51

ذٰلِكَ بِمَا قَدَّمَتْ اَيْدِيْكُمْ وَاَنَّ اللّٰهَ لَيْسَ بِظَلَّامٍ لِّلْعَبِيْدِۙ

Żālika bimā qaddamat aidīkum wa annallāha laisa biẓallāmil lil-‘abīd(i).

That is for what your hands have put forth [of evil] and because Allāh is not ever unjust to [His] servants."

Ayah 52

كَدَأْبِ اٰلِ فِرْعَوْنَۙ وَالَّذِيْنَ مِنْ قَبْلِهِمْۗ كَفَرُوْا بِاٰيٰتِ اللّٰهِ فَاَخَذَهُمُ اللّٰهُ بِذُنُوْبِهِمْۗ اِنَّ اللّٰهَ قَوِيٌّ شَدِيْدُ الْعِقَابِ

Kada'bi āli fir‘aun(a), wal-lażīna min qablihim, kafarū bi'āyātillāhi fa akhażahumullāhu biżunūbihim, innallāha qawiyyun syadīdul-‘iqāb(i).

[Theirs is] like the custom of the people of Pharaoh and of those before them. They disbelieved in the signs of Allāh, so Allāh seized them for their sins. Indeed, Allāh is Powerful and severe in penalty.

Ayah 53

ذٰلِكَ بِاَنَّ اللّٰهَ لَمْ يَكُ مُغَيِّرًا نِّعْمَةً اَنْعَمَهَا عَلٰى قَوْمٍ حَتّٰى يُغَيِّرُوْا مَا بِاَنْفُسِهِمْۙ وَاَنَّ اللّٰهَ سَمِيْعٌ عَلِيْمٌۙ

Żālika bi'annallāha lam yaku mugayyiran ni‘matan an‘amahā ‘alā qaumin ḥattā yugayyirū mā bi'anfusihim, wa annallāha samī‘un ‘alīm(un).

That is because Allāh would not change a favor which He had bestowed upon a people until they change what is within themselves. And indeed, Allāh is Hearing and Knowing.

Ayah 54

كَدَأْبِ اٰلِ فِرْعَوْنَۙ وَالَّذِيْنَ مِنْ قَبْلِهِمْۚ كَذَّبُوْا بِاٰيٰتِ رَبِّهِمْ فَاَهْلَكْنٰهُمْ بِذُنُوْبِهِمْ وَاَغْرَقْنَآ اٰلَ فِرْعَوْنَۚ وَكُلٌّ كَانُوْا ظٰلِمِيْنَ

Kada'bi āli fir‘aun(a), wal-lażīna min qablihim, każżabū bi'āyāti rabbihim fa ahlaknāhum biżunūbihim wa agraqnā āla fir‘aun(a), wa kullun kānū ẓālimīn(a).

[Theirs is] like the custom of the people of Pharaoh and of those before them. They denied the signs of their Lord, so We destroyed them for their sins, and We drowned the people of Pharaoh. And all [of them] were wrongdoers.

Ayah 55

اِنَّ شَرَّ الدَّوَاۤبِّ عِنْدَ اللّٰهِ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ا فَهُمْ لَا يُؤْمِنُوْنَۖ

Inna syarrad-dawābbi ‘indallāhil-lażīna kafarū fahum lā yu'minūn(a).

Indeed, the worst of living creatures in the sight of Allāh are those who have disbelieved, and they will not [ever] believe-

Ayah 56

الَّذِيْنَ عَاهَدْتَّ مِنْهُمْ ثُمَّ يَنْقُضُوْنَ عَهْدَهُمْ فِيْ كُلِّ مَرَّةٍ وَّهُمْ لَا يَتَّقُوْنَ

Allażīna ‘āhatta minhum ṡumma yanquḍūna ‘ahdahum fī kulli marratiw wa hum lā yattaqūn(a).

The ones with whom you made a treaty but then they break their pledge every time, and they do not fear Allāh.

Ayah 57

فَاِمَّا تَثْقَفَنَّهُمْ فِى الْحَرْبِ فَشَرِّدْ بِهِمْ مَّنْ خَلْفَهُمْ لَعَلَّهُمْ يَذَّكَّرُوْنَ

Fa immā taṡqafannahum fil-ḥarbi fa syarrid bihim man khalfahum la‘allahum yażżakkarūn(a).

So if you, [O Muḥammad], gain dominance over them in war, disperse by [means of] them those behind them that perhaps they will be reminded.

Ayah 58

وَاِمَّا تَخَافَنَّ مِنْ قَوْمٍ خِيَانَةً فَانْۢبِذْ اِلَيْهِمْ عَلٰى سَوَاۤءٍۗ اِنَّ اللّٰهَ لَا يُحِبُّ الْخَاۤىِٕنِيْنَ ࣖ

Wa immā takhāfanna min qaumin khiyānatan fambiż ilaihim ‘alā sawā'(in), innallāha lā yuḥibbul-khā'inīn(a).

If you [have reason to] fear from a people betrayal, throw [their treaty] back to them, [putting you] on equal terms. Indeed, Allāh does not like traitors.

Ayah 59

وَلَا يَحْسَبَنَّ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ا سَبَقُوْاۗ اِنَّهُمْ لَا يُعْجِزُوْنَ

Wa lā yaḥsabannal-lażīna kafarū sabaqū, innahum lā yu‘jizūn(a).

And let not those who disbelieve think they will escape. Indeed, they will not cause failure [to Allāh].

Ayah 60

وَاَعِدُّوْا لَهُمْ مَّا اسْتَطَعْتُمْ مِّنْ قُوَّةٍ وَّمِنْ رِّبَاطِ الْخَيْلِ تُرْهِبُوْنَ بِهٖ عَدُوَّ اللّٰهِ وَعَدُوَّكُمْ وَاٰخَرِيْنَ مِنْ دُوْنِهِمْۚ لَا تَعْلَمُوْنَهُمْۚ اَللّٰهُ يَعْلَمُهُمْۗ وَمَا تُنْفِقُوْا مِنْ شَيْءٍ فِيْ سَبِيْلِ اللّٰهِ يُوَفَّ اِلَيْكُمْ وَاَنْتُمْ لَا تُظْلَمُوْنَ

Wa a‘iddū lahum mastaṭa‘tum min quwwatiw wa mir ribāṭil-khaili turhibūna bihī ‘aduwwallāhi wa ‘aduwwakum wa ākharīna min dūnihim, lā ta‘lamūnahum, allāhu ya‘lamuhum, wa mā tunfiqū min syai'in fī sabīlillāhi yuwaffa ilaikum wa antum lā tuẓlamūn(a).

And prepare against them whatever you are able of power and of steeds of war by which you may terrify the enemy of Allāh and your enemy and others besides them whom you do not know [but] whom Allāh knows. And whatever you spend in the cause of Allāh will be fully repaid to you, and you will not be wronged.

Ayah 61

۞ وَاِنْ جَنَحُوْا لِلسَّلْمِ فَاجْنَحْ لَهَا وَتَوَكَّلْ عَلَى اللّٰهِ ۗاِنَّهٗ هُوَ السَّمِيْعُ الْعَلِيْمُ

Wa in janaḥū lis-salmi fajnaḥ lahā wa tawakkal ‘alallāh(i), innahū huwas-samī‘ul-‘alīm(u).

And if they incline to peace, then incline to it [also] and rely upon Allāh. Indeed, it is He who is the Hearing, the Knowing.

Ayah 62

وَاِنْ يُّرِيْدُوْٓا اَنْ يَّخْدَعُوْكَ فَاِنَّ حَسْبَكَ اللّٰهُ ۗهُوَ الَّذِيْٓ اَيَّدَكَ بِنَصْرِهٖ وَبِالْمُؤْمِنِيْنَۙ

Wa iy yurīdū ay yakhda‘ūka fa inna ḥasbakallāh(u), huwal-lażī ayyadaka binaṣrihī wa bil-mu'minīn(a).

But if they intend to deceive you - then sufficient for you is Allāh. It is He who supported you with His help and with the believers

Ayah 63

وَاَلَّفَ بَيْنَ قُلُوْبِهِمْۗ لَوْاَنْفَقْتَ مَا فِى الْاَرْضِ جَمِيْعًا مَّآ اَلَّفْتَ بَيْنَ قُلُوْبِهِمْ وَلٰكِنَّ اللّٰهَ اَلَّفَ بَيْنَهُمْۗ اِنَّهٗ عَزِيْزٌ حَكِيْمٌ

Wa allafa baina qulūbihim, lau anfaqta mā fil-arḍi jamī‘am mā allafta baina qulūbihim wa lākinnallāha allafa bainahum, innahū ‘azīzun ḥakīm(un).

And brought together their hearts. If you had spent all that is in the earth, you could not have brought their hearts together; but Allāh brought them together. Indeed, He is Exalted in Might and Wise.

Ayah 64

يٰٓاَيُّهَا النَّبِيُّ حَسْبُكَ اللّٰهُ وَمَنِ اتَّبَعَكَ مِنَ الْمُؤْمِنِيْنَ ࣖ

Yā ayyuhan-nabiyyu ḥasbukallāhu wa manittaba‘aka minal-mu'minīn(a).

O Prophet, sufficient for you is Allāh and for whoever follows you of the believers.

Ayah 65

يٰٓاَيُّهَا النَّبِيُّ حَرِّضِ الْمُؤْمِنِيْنَ عَلَى الْقِتَالِۗ اِنْ يَّكُنْ مِّنْكُمْ عِشْرُوْنَ صٰبِرُوْنَ يَغْلِبُوْا مِائَتَيْنِۚ وَاِنْ يَّكُنْ مِّنْكُمْ مِّائَةٌ يَّغْلِبُوْٓا اَلْفًا مِّنَ الَ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ا بِاَنَّهُمْ قَوْمٌ لَّا يَفْقَهُوْنَ

Yā ayyuhan-nabiyyu ḥarriḍil-mu'minīna ‘alal-qitāl(i), iy yakum minkum ‘isyrūna ṣabirūna yaglibū mi'atain(i), wa iy yakum minkum mi'atuy yaglibū alfam minal-lażīna kafarū bi'annahum qaumul lā yafqahūn(a).

O Prophet, urge the believers to battle. If there are among you twenty [who are] steadfast, they will overcome two hundred. And if there are among you one hundred [who are steadfast], they will overcome a thousand of those who have disbelieved because they are a people who do not understand.

Ayah 66

اَلْـٰٔنَ خَفَّفَ اللّٰهُ عَنْكُمْ وَعَلِمَ اَنَّ فِيْكُمْ ضَعْفًاۗ فَاِنْ يَّكُنْ مِّنْكُمْ مِّائَةٌ صَابِرَةٌ يَّغْلِبُوْا مِائَتَيْنِۚ وَاِنْ يَّكُنْ مِّنْكُمْ اَلْفٌ يَّغْلِبُوْٓا اَلْفَيْنِ بِاِذْنِ اللّٰهِ ۗوَاللّٰهُ مَعَ الصّٰبِرِيْنَ

Al'āna khaffafallāhu ‘ankum wa ‘alima anna fīkum ḍa‘fā(n), fa iy yakum minkum mi'atun ṣābiratuy yaglibū mi'atain(i), wa iy yakum minkum alfuy yaglibū alfaini bi'iżnillāh(i), wallāhu ma‘aṣ-ṣābirīn(a).

Now, Allāh has lightened [the hardship] for you, and He knows that among you is weakness. So if there are from you one hundred [who are] steadfast, they will overcome two hundred. And if there are among you a thousand, they will overcome two thousand by permission of Allāh. And Allāh is with the steadfast.

Ayah 67

مَاكَانَ لِنَبِيٍّ اَنْ يَّكُوْنَ لَهٗٓ اَسْرٰى حَتّٰى يُثْخِنَ فِى الْاَرْضِۗ تُرِيْدُوْنَ عَرَضَ الدُّنْيَاۖ وَاللّٰهُ يُرِيْدُ الْاٰخِرَةَۗ وَاللّٰهُ عَزِيْزٌحَكِيْمٌ

Mā kāna linabiyyin ay yakūna lahū asrā ḥattā yuṡkhina fil-arḍ(i), turīdūna ‘araḍad-dun-yā, wallāhu yurīdul-ākhirah(ta), wallāhu ‘azīzun ḥakīm(un).

It is not for a prophet to have captives [of war] until he inflicts a massacre [upon Allāh's enemies] in the land. You [i.e., some Muslims] desire the commodities of this world, but Allāh desires [for you] the Hereafter. And Allāh is Exalted in Might and Wise.

Ayah 68

لَوْلَاكِتٰبٌ مِّنَ اللّٰهِ سَبَقَ لَمَسَّكُمْ فِيْمَآ اَخَذْتُمْ عَذَابٌ عَظِيْمٌ

Lau lā kitābum minallāhi sabaqa lamassakum fīmā akhażtum ‘ażābun ‘aẓīm(un).

If not for a decree from Allāh that preceded, you would have been touched for what you took by a great punishment.

Ayah 69

فَكُلُوْا مِمَّاغَنِمْتُمْ حَلٰلًا طَيِّبًاۖ وَّاتَّقُوا اللّٰهَ ۗاِنَّ اللّٰهَ غَفُوْرٌ رَّحِيْمٌ

Fa kulū mimmā ganimtum ḥalālan ṭayyibā(n), wattaqullāh(a), innallāha gafūrur raḥīm(un).

So consume what you have taken of war booty [as being] lawful and good, and fear Allāh. Indeed, Allāh is Forgiving and Merciful.

Ayah 70

يٰٓاَيُّهَا النَّبِيُّ قُلْ لِّمَنْ فِيْٓ اَيْدِيْكُمْ مِّنَ الْاَسْرٰٓىۙ اِنْ يَّعْلَمِ اللّٰهُ فِيْ قُلُوْبِكُمْ خَيْرًا يُّؤْتِكُمْ خَيْرًا مِّمَّآ اُخِذَ مِنْكُمْ وَيَغْفِرْ لَكُمْۗ وَاللّٰهُ غَفُوْرٌ رَّحِيْمٌ ࣖ

Yā ayyuhan-nabiyyu qul liman fī aidīkum minal-asrā, iy ya‘lamillāhu fī qulūbikum khairay yu'tikum khairam mimmā ukhiża minkum wa yagfir lakum, wallāhu gafūrur raḥīm(un).

O Prophet, say to whoever is in your hands of the captives, "If Allāh knows [any] good in your hearts, He will give you [something] better than what was taken from you, and He will forgive you; and Allāh is Forgiving and Merciful."

Ayah 71

وَاِنْ يُّرِيْدُوْا خِيَانَتَكَ فَقَدْ خَانُوا اللّٰهَ مِنْ قَبْلُ فَاَمْكَنَ مِنْهُمْ وَاللّٰهُ عَلِيْمٌ حَكِيْمٌ

Wa iy yurīdū khiyānataka faqad khānullāha min qablu fa amkana minhum wallāhu ‘alīmun ḥakim(un).

But if they intend to betray you - then they have already betrayed Allāh before, and He empowered [you] over them. And Allāh is Knowing and Wise.

Ayah 72

اِنَّ الَ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ْا وَهَاجَرُوْا وَجَاهَدُوْا بِاَمْوَالِهِمْ وَاَنْفُسِهِمْ فِيْ سَبِيْلِ اللّٰهِ وَالَّذِيْنَ اٰوَوْا وَّنَصَرُوْٓا اُولٰۤىِٕكَ بَعْضُهُمْ اَوْلِيَاۤءُ بَعْضٍۗ وَالَ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ْا وَلَمْ يُهَاجِرُوْا مَا لَكُمْ مِّنْ وَّلَايَتِهِمْ مِّنْ شَيْءٍ حَتّٰى يُهَاجِرُوْاۚ وَاِنِ اسْتَنْصَرُوْكُمْ فِى الدِّيْنِ فَعَلَيْكُمُ النَّصْرُ اِلَّا عَلٰى قَوْمٍۢ بَيْنَكُمْ وَبَيْنَهُمْ مِّيْثَاقٌۗ وَاللّٰهُ بِمَا تَعْمَلُوْنَ بَصِيْرٌ

Innal-lażīna āmanū wa hājarū wa jāhadū bi'amwālihim wa anfusihim fī sabīlillāhi wal-lażīna āwaw wa naṣarū ulā'ika ba‘ḍuhum auliyā'u ba‘ḍ(in), wal-lażīna āmanū wa lam yuhājirū mā lakum miw walāyatihim min syai'in ḥattā yuhājirū, wa inistanṣarūkum fid-dīni fa ‘alaikumun naṣru illā ‘alā qaumim bainakum wa bainahum mīṡāq(un), wallāhu bimā ta‘malūna baṣīr(un).

Indeed, those who have believed and emigrated and fought with their wealth and lives in the cause of Allāh and those who gave shelter and aided - they are allies of one another. But those who believed and did not emigrate - for you there is no support of them until they emigrate. And if they seek help of you for the religion, then you must help, except against a people between yourselves and whom is a treaty. And Allāh is Seeing of what you do.

Ayah 73

وَالَّذِيْنَ كَفَرُوْا بَعْضُهُمْ اَوْلِيَاۤءُ بَعْضٍۗ اِلَّا تَفْعَلُوْهُ تَكُنْ فِتْنَةٌ فِى الْاَرْضِ وَفَسَادٌ كَبِيْرٌۗ

Wal-lażīna kafarū ba‘ḍuhum auliyā'u ba‘ḍ(in), illā taf‘alūhu takun fitnatun fil-arḍi wa fasādun kabīr(un).

And those who disbelieved are allies of one another. If you do not do so [i.e., ally yourselves with other believers], there will be fitnah [i.e., disbelief and oppression] on earth and great corruption.

Ayah 74

وَالَ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ْا وَهَاجَرُوْا وَجَاهَدُوْا فِيْ سَبِيْلِ اللّٰهِ وَالَّذِيْنَ اٰوَوْا وَّنَصَرُوْٓا اُولٰۤىِٕكَ هُمُ الْمُؤْمِنُوْنَ حَقًّاۗ لَهُمْ مَّغْفِرَةٌ وَّرِزْقٌ كَرِيْمٌ

Wal-lażīna āmanū wa hājarū wa jāhadū fī sabīlillāhi wal-lażīna āwaw wa naṣarū ulā'ika humul-mu'minūna ḥaqqā(n), lahum magfirtuw wa rizqun karīm(un).

But those who have believed and emigrated and fought in the cause of Allāh and those who gave shelter and aided - it is they who are the believers, truly. For them is forgiveness and noble provision.

Ayah 75

وَالَّذِيْنَ اٰمَنُوْا مِنْۢ بَعْدُ وَهَاجَرُوْا وَجَاهَدُوْا مَعَكُمْ فَاُولٰۤىِٕكَ مِنْكُمْۗ وَاُولُوا الْاَرْحَامِ بَعْضُهُمْ اَوْلٰى بِبَعْضٍ فِيْ كِتٰبِ اللّٰهِ ۗاِنَّ اللّٰهَ بِكُلِّ شَيْءٍ عَلِيْمٌ ࣖ

Wal-lażīna āmanū mim ba‘du wa hājarū wa jāhadū ma‘akum fa ulā'ika minkum, wa ulul-arḥāmi ba‘ḍuhum aulā biba‘ḍin fī kitābillāh(i), innallāha bikulli syai'in ‘alīm(un).

And those who believed after [the initial emigration] and emigrated and fought with you - they are of you. But those of [blood] relationship are more entitled [to inheritance] in the decree of Allāh. Indeed, Allāh is Knowing of all things.
